Comprehensive SQL Course:Hands-on Project & Coding Exercises
Comprehensive SQL Course:Hands-on Project & Coding Exercises, available at $44.99, has an average rating of 4.65, with 130 lectures, 125 quizzes, based on 202 reviews, and has 1458 subscribers.
You will learn about You will learn how to create database tables, alter an existing table and drop a table that's not required using SQL You will learn how to query data from a table, apply transformations using functions, filter and sort the data returned using SQL You will learn how to join multiple tables, summarise the data as required to produce summaries using SQL You will learn how to use sub queries and common table expressions to implement complex logic using SQL You will learn how to create and work with views to simplify complex solutions using SQL Using SQL, you will learn how to use window functions to carry out complex data analysis with ease Using SQL, you will learn how to design and implement a database for a real world project You will learn how to write SQL queries required to satisfy the requirements for a real world project This course is ideal for individuals who are University students looking for a career in Information Technology or Software Engineers working with data, i.e, Web Developers, App Developers etc or Anyone interested in Data Engineering, Data Analysis, Data Science, Business Intelligence etc It is particularly useful for University students looking for a career in Information Technology or Software Engineers working with data, i.e, Web Developers, App Developers etc or Anyone interested in Data Engineering, Data Analysis, Data Science, Business Intelligence etc.
Enroll now: Comprehensive SQL Course:Hands-on Project & Coding Exercises
Summary
Title: Comprehensive SQL Course:Hands-on Project & Coding Exercises
Price: $44.99
Average Rating: 4.65
Number of Lectures: 130
Number of Quizzes: 125
Number of Published Lectures: 130
Number of Published Quizzes: 125
Number of Curriculum Items: 255
Number of Published Curriculum Objects: 255
Original Price: $27.99
Quality Status: approved
Status: Live
What You Will Learn
- You will learn how to create database tables, alter an existing table and drop a table that's not required using SQL
- You will learn how to query data from a table, apply transformations using functions, filter and sort the data returned using SQL
- You will learn how to join multiple tables, summarise the data as required to produce summaries using SQL
- You will learn how to use sub queries and common table expressions to implement complex logic using SQL
- You will learn how to create and work with views to simplify complex solutions using SQL
- Using SQL, you will learn how to use window functions to carry out complex data analysis with ease
- Using SQL, you will learn how to design and implement a database for a real world project
- You will learn how to write SQL queries required to satisfy the requirements for a real world project
Who Should Attend
- University students looking for a career in Information Technology
- Software Engineers working with data, i.e, Web Developers, App Developers etc
- Anyone interested in Data Engineering, Data Analysis, Data Science, Business Intelligence etc
Target Audiences
- University students looking for a career in Information Technology
- Software Engineers working with data, i.e, Web Developers, App Developers etc
- Anyone interested in Data Engineering, Data Analysis, Data Science, Business Intelligence etc
Welcome!
I am looking forward to helping you with learning SQL, one of the fundamental skills required to become a data professional. SQL is one of the important skill required to become data engineers, data analysts, data scientists, web developers, application developer etc.
This is a hand-on course with 120+ SQL coding exercises and a real world project of building a database for one of the popular sporting tournaments, Indian Premier League and writing all the SQL statements required for the scorecard of the tournament website.
No downloads or database installations required.I teach this SQL course using the Udemy’s coding exercises platform which comes with a database installed for you! You just need a web browser with any device (i.e., iPad, tablet, laptop) to practice SQL!
Once you have completed the course including all the SQL coding exercises and the project, I strongly believe that you will be in a position to start working in a real world data project using SQL.
I value your time as much as I do mine. So, I have designed this SQL course to be fast-paced and to the point. Also, the course has been taught with simple English and no jargons. I start the course from basics and by the end of the course you will be proficient in SQL.
Currently this course teaches you the following
-
Basics of SQL statements
-
Querying Data
-
Filtering Data
-
Simple SQL functions
-
Date Functions
-
Conditional Expressions & Functions
-
Aggregate Functions
-
Grouping Data
-
SQL Joins
-
SQL Constraints
-
Primary & Foreign Keys and Relationships
-
Database Design & Entity Relationship Diagrams
-
Subqueries
-
Common Table Expressions (CTEs)
-
Views
-
Window/ Analytical Functions
-
Working with a Real World Project
This course assumes no prior knowledge of SQL or any programming language. Once you complete the course, I genuinely believe that you will be in a position to confidently work in a real time project using SQL!
Course Curriculum
Chapter 1: Beginner – Comprehensive SQL Course Introduction
Lecture 1: SQL Course Introduction
Lecture 2: SQL Course Structure
Lecture 3: Course Slides Download
Chapter 2: Beginner – Overviews
Lecture 1: Introduction to SQL
Lecture 2: Udemy Coding Exercises Overview
Lecture 3: SQLite Documentation (Optional)
Chapter 3: Beginner – Introduction to SQL Statements
Lecture 1: Section Overview
Lecture 2: Creating Tables
Lecture 3: Writing SQL Statement – Best Practices
Lecture 4: Inserting Single Record
Lecture 5: Inserting Multiple Records
Lecture 6: Selecting Data
Lecture 7: Filtering Data
Lecture 8: Updating Data
Lecture 9: Deleting Data
Lecture 10: Dropping Tables
Lecture 11: Code Used During Demonstration
Chapter 4: Beginner – Querying Data
Lecture 1: Querying Data – Overview
Lecture 2: Select Clause Overview
Lecture 3: Renaming Columns – Column Alias
Lecture 4: Removing Duplicates – DISTINCT
Lecture 5: FROM Clause Overview
Lecture 6: Sorting Outputs by Single Column – ORDER BY
Lecture 7: Sorting Outputs by Multiple Columns and Positions – ORDER BY
Lecture 8: Restricting number of records – LIMIT
Lecture 9: Code Used During Demonstration
Chapter 5: Beginner – Filtering Data
Lecture 1: Introduction to Filtering Data
Lecture 2: Filtering Using Mathematical Operators
Lecture 3: Filter Data Using BETWEEN Operator
Lecture 4: Filter Data Using Like Operator and Percentage Wildcard
Lecture 5: Filter Data Using Like Operator and Underscore Wildcard
Lecture 6: Filter Data Using Like Operator – Bringing It All Together
Lecture 7: Filter Data Using IN Operator
Lecture 8: Filter Data Using Multiple Conditions – AND Operator
Lecture 9: Filter Data Using Multiple Conditions – OR Operator
Lecture 10: Filter Data Using Multiple Conditions – Bringing It All Together
Lecture 11: Filter Data Using Negative Conditions
Lecture 12: Filters in UPDATE and DELETE Statements
Lecture 13: Code Used During Demonstration
Chapter 6: Intermediate – Simple SQL Functions
Lecture 1: SQL Functions – Overview
Lecture 2: String Functions – UPPER, LOWER, CONCAT
Lecture 3: String Functions – REPLACE, TRIM
Lecture 4: String Functions – SUBSTR, INSTR, LENGTH
Lecture 5: Math Functions
Lecture 6: Nested Function Calls
Lecture 7: Code Used During Demonstration
Chapter 7: Intermediate – Conditional Functions & Expressions
Lecture 1: Conditional Functions – IIF
Lecture 2: Simple CASE Expression
Lecture 3: Searched CASE Expression
Lecture 4: Introduction to NULLs
Instructors
-
Ramesh Retnasamy
Senior Data Engineer/ Machine Learning Engineer
Rating Distribution
- 1 stars: 2 votes
- 2 stars: 1 votes
- 3 stars: 12 votes
- 4 stars: 56 votes
- 5 stars: 131 votes
Frequently Asked Questions
How long do I have access to the course materials?
You can view and review the lecture materials indefinitely, like an on-demand channel.
Can I take my courses with me wherever I go?
Definitely! If you have an internet connection, courses on Udemy are available on any device at any time. If you don’t have an internet connection, some instructors also let their students download course lectures. That’s up to the instructor though, so make sure you get on their good side!
You may also like
- Top 10 Language Learning Courses to Learn in November 2024
- Top 10 Video Editing Courses to Learn in November 2024
- Top 10 Music Production Courses to Learn in November 2024
- Top 10 Animation Courses to Learn in November 2024
- Top 10 Digital Illustration Courses to Learn in November 2024
- Top 10 Renewable Energy Courses to Learn in November 2024
- Top 10 Sustainable Living Courses to Learn in November 2024
- Top 10 Ethical AI Courses to Learn in November 2024
- Top 10 Cybersecurity Fundamentals Courses to Learn in November 2024
- Top 10 Smart Home Technology Courses to Learn in November 2024
- Top 10 Holistic Health Courses to Learn in November 2024
- Top 10 Nutrition And Diet Planning Courses to Learn in November 2024
- Top 10 Yoga Instruction Courses to Learn in November 2024
- Top 10 Stress Management Courses to Learn in November 2024
- Top 10 Mindfulness Meditation Courses to Learn in November 2024
- Top 10 Life Coaching Courses to Learn in November 2024
- Top 10 Career Development Courses to Learn in November 2024
- Top 10 Relationship Building Courses to Learn in November 2024
- Top 10 Parenting Skills Courses to Learn in November 2024
- Top 10 Home Improvement Courses to Learn in November 2024